Context

During the school year, teachers typically deliver internet-safety lessons in a formal classroom setting, but there is a lack of equivalent informal-environment activities, even though informal settings allow safe-behaviour principles to be conveyed more flexibly and enjoyably. Running the project during summer made it easier to reach children already gathered at summer camps for other activities.

Activities

The team visited summer camps and foster homes to run informal internet-safety events, reaching children from a range of backgrounds, including — unplanned — children from Ukraine present at some of the camps visited.

Conclusions

Key learning points: safer internet is a topic needing sustained attention, and summer camps offer new potential for informal learning; interactive summer-camp activities help children and young people develop skills to safely use smart devices and raise awareness of internet safety and etiquette; and an inclusive approach to digital literacy means reaching target groups wherever they are.
